研究實驗一 搭建乙個精簡的C語言開發環境

2021-07-03 15:33:18 字數 1059 閱讀 3029

研究實驗一  搭建乙個精簡的c語言開發環境

實驗內容

了解解決某些問題需要的具體程式和檔案,通過編輯乙個簡單的c語言程式,進行編譯、連線過程中,一步一步的加入需要的一些檔案及程式,清晰的觀察其過程,從而掌握每個檔案或程式的作用。

實驗環境

win7 、dosbox、tc2.0

實驗步驟

1.      首先在dos環境下,建立tc2.0的資料夾和minic資料夾,用到md命令。

2.      在minic資料夾中操作,首先吧tc.exe拷貝到該資料夾下,並執行。

3.      在tc.exe環境中編輯程式******.c,儲存在minic中。

4.      將******.c通過compile選項中的compile to obj 進行編譯,發現編譯成功。

5.      通過compile選項中的link exe file,將******.obj連線為******.exe,發現如下資訊

是因為在minic下沒有c0s.obj檔案,所以將這個檔案拷貝到該目錄下

繼續進行連線,會發現還缺少檔案,將它們都拷貝過來,之後成功連線檔案。

所需檔案是:c0s.obj、emu.lib、maths.lib、graphics.lib、cs.lib

6.      生成******.exe檔案後執行

發現程式正確執行了。

總結

編寫簡單c語言程式,在經過編譯、連線過程中發現,可以正常編譯為.obj檔案,但是在連線為.exe檔案過程中需要一些其他的程式或檔案,通過錯誤資訊將所需的檔案拷入,之後再一步一步的執行,很清晰的看到了要成功連線乙個檔案所需要的檔案或程式,對程式的編譯、連線過程有了更清晰的了解。

乙個C 鐘錶小實驗

好,在mooc上學習c 有個鐘錶小實驗,一時興起就跟著做了。對於我來說還是有點新穎的 貼上 include include using namespace std class clock void clock set int h,int m,int s,float p 設定修改四個資料成員值的函式 ...

乙個c語言程式

include include include void shuffle int wdeck 4 13 void deal int wdeck 4 13 char wface 13 char wsuit 4 int main char wface 13 int wdeck 4 13 printf 這...

乙個有趣的實驗

import numpy as np list1 初始時每個賬戶都有1塊錢 for i in range 100 輪轉開始,對於每個賬戶,可以任選1個賬戶,並從自己的資金中分配乙個隨機數額給他 for t in range 1000 輪轉1000次 for i in range 100 對於賬戶i,...